Apple pencil now completly broken ios 14
AlainP replied to AlainP's topic in [ARCHIVE] Photo beta on iPad threads
1 st image: Normal screen opening the picture when the "View Tool" is selected by default 2 nd image: As soon as the Brush Tool is selected the bottom of the screen display the menu from "Apple Notes". The brush cannot be changed using the pencil. Selecting with the finger still works. Only happens if Scribble is enabled. It works normally if Scribble is off. But let's not forget iOS 14 is in beta as is Photo version .186. -
Some hotkeys work only in English.
AlainP replied to Max N's topic in [ARCHIVE] Photo beta on Windows threads
I use a French Canadian keyboard and I have to remap the shortcut keys for changing brush size (and other tools). I use the same [ and ] that are displayed on the physical keys, but they send another ascii code. It takes a few seconds and it's done for good. -

I did not add this to Photo and Windows Ink is not checked in the Wacom app and everything works perfectly in the latest beta.... will there be any difference if I add this to the command line of Photo? Edit: I just tried with and without --legacy-wintab .... since I installed the latest beta I did not add this to the command line. I checked before starting Photo and it was not there, my Wacom pen worked perfectly, pressure, zoom, size and opacity.... everything was perfect. I edited the command line and added --legacy-wintab to it. Restarted Photo and my pen was still working very fine, so I edited the command line again and removed it. Then my pen stopped working fine, it was working like the previous version.... I now need to have this --legacy-wintab. Does this make any sense?
